Output 3fa5148da7731bab4b6a20e21b79942cec12146db895cf8e82e943de406c5a01:0

value
28149272
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d42f59cca87aa685b2d8e8c00f07ef356daa76c OP_EQUALVERIFY OP_CHECKSIG
address
1DsvVUHTbUzRxfWee7JuzWfN1Mri9KBcYr
transaction
3fa5148da7731bab4b6a20e21b79942cec12146db895cf8e82e943de406c5a01
spent
true